Kraus" <kak6@p.......> Subject: Re: Feeding the Beast Spoilers, Nick and Sex Gayle wrote: >Back again to the knightly courtship... >A Lady supplies the chaste love, the dream, the cure, the courage to >endure. >Sex is simply something easily had with the slut du jour. And Tippi responded: >He has sex with Janette a bunch -- and he still married HER! ;) Ah, but didn't Nick feel he was "in love" with Janette while they were married? He admitted as much to Lacroix after she left him in the POTM flashback. This would fit into Nick's version of courtly love. If the timing works (and I'm not sure it does, so historians help me out! This is the way I remember hearing it), the idea of AMOR, or romantic, heart-felt love as we understand it today, was started in the 12th century. So there, maybe, is Nick. Janette is 11th century, when you've only got EROS, or sexual excitement on a physical level (felt about 1foot below the heart <g>), and AGAPE, or brotherly love. She would predate the romantic notions. Actually, this could explain a lot about the N/J relationship. The marriage doesn't last because she feels smothered, but the physical side of the relationship is, uh, less of a problem. (Nick's Amor doesn't seem to completely block his Eros. He and Janette Eros all over each other. :-) He's just turned his Amor to Nat.) The Janette I know and love is the one who, among many other things: - was once an abused, noble born prostitute (who still took the time to care for and try to protect one of her fellow prostitutes) and, in the present day, sheltered prostitutes and vampires at the Raven (FWTD); - called Natalie and Schanke to rescue Nick from himself, when Nick re-vamped himself (FtB); - risked her life to prove that her lover was innocent so that his son would not grow up believing that his father was a criminal (HF); - tried to protect Natalie from the vampires when Natalie lost control (AMPH); - agreed to let Schanke stay in the Raven for protection (even though it endangered the vampires who slept there) and took the time to keep him company (Hunters).
